Quick red lentil Bolognese: great healthy family recipe!

Red lentil Bolognese with pasta – very tasty! Red lentils are not only rich in protein and fiber, but they also go particularly well with tomato sauces. Due to their fine consistency, they are even reminiscent of minced meat – perfect for a vegan or vegetarian version of the classic Bolognese.

Start the new year with healthy family recipes!

We all know how important healthy family recipes are. As parents, we want to cook healthy food because it helps ensure that all family members receive a balanced and nutritious diet.

My biggest challenge at home is cooking delicious and healthy recipes that everyone enjoys. Do you know that, too? Sometimes my children just don’t want to eat everything I put in front of them.

We parents simply have to be smarter than our little connoisseurs! I then try to pimp up my kids’ favorite foods with a pinch of health. This works well with hidden vegetables.

I then like to add pureed vegetables, which work great, especially in tomato sauces or bolognese. Or I try grated carrots and a few oats here and there. These are just a few examples of how I experiment with healthy family recipes.

Why healthy family recipes are important

By preparing healthy meals at home, we as parents can ensure that our kids are getting enough fruits, vegetables, whole grains and proteins. This promotes their physical health and development.

Healthy family recipes can also help prevent obesity and illnesses such as diabetes or cardiovascular disease. If we parents model and teach our children healthy eating habits, it is a great start to a healthy life.

Eating together strengthens family solidarity and ensures a pleasant eating culture. By cooking and eating together with us parents, children learn valuable skills in handling food and preparing meals.
